Transaction 70a66b04697c2d73b92d67a8247816352ffa55a3abd9096326ec493e6276c874

1 Input
2 Outputs
  • 70a66b04697c2d73b92d67a8247816352ffa55a3abd9096326ec493e6276c874:0
  • value  1962231
    address  13DdbXd5QsaauW56rdFJCzPujDWyCj3Tau
  • 70a66b04697c2d73b92d67a8247816352ffa55a3abd9096326ec493e6276c874:1
  • value  9808017
    address  1NPKJr4ApVnkw1F7UJ13GdcDZhfR2Ui4wo